1. What Is the Hydroponic Nutrient Market?
The Hydroponic Nutrient Market comprises the global production, distribution, and commercial and consumer application of water-soluble mineral nutrient solution concentrates, premixed nutrient formulations, and specialized additive products that provide the complete mineral nutrition required for plant growth in hydroponic, aeroponic, and soilless controlled environment agriculture growing systems where plant roots access nutrients exclusively from nutrient solution rather than soil mineral weathering. The market includes multi-part concentrated hydroponic nutrient concentrates requiring grower dilution and mixing for target elemental concentration, single-part premixed hydroponic nutrient solutions for simplified growing program management at small to medium growing scale, crop-specific hydroponic nutrient formulations optimized for lettuce, tomato, cannabis, and specialty crop elemental requirement profiles, organic and biological hydroponic nutrient products using plant extract, seaweed, compost tea, and microbial product formulations for certified organic hydroponic production programs, and specialty additive and supplement products including rooting hormones, silica supplement, calcium-magnesium supplement, and beneficial microbe inoculant for hydroponic growing performance enhancement. These products serve commercial plant factory and vertical farm operators requiring large-volume crop-specific hydroponic nutrient supply for continuous production facility nutrient management, commercial greenhouse hydroponic tomato, cucumber, and pepper producers using nutrient solution management systems with crop-stage-optimized elemental formulation, cannabis indoor growers using specialty high-performance hydroponic nutrient programs for high-yield and cannabinoid-quality-targeted growing programs, hobby and home hydroponic growers using consumer-packaged nutrient solution products for small-scale food production, and organic hydroponic certification program operators requiring certified organic nutrient formulations for OMRI-listed organic-compliant growing programs. The market covers all commercial hydroponic nutrient products including primary nutrient solutions, additives, supplements, and organic nutrient formulations for controlled environment agriculture applications.

3. Emerging Technologies
- Precision nutrient formulation optimization using plant tissue analysis feedback for automated nutrient solution elemental concentration adjustment based on measured crop tissue elemental status is advancing for crop-stage-optimized nutrient management in commercial growing programs. Growing adoption at commercial plant factory programs is being driven by the crop quality improvement from tissue-guided nutrient management.
- Closed-loop hydroponic nutrient recirculation system design using capture drainage, remineralization dosing, and sterilization for complete nutrient recirculation without discharge in zero-emission commercial hydroponic growing is advancing for regulatory compliance in sensitive water environment growing locations. Continued development of closed recirculation is enabling zero-discharge growing system compliance.
- Beneficial microbial inoculant integration in hydroponic nutrient programs using mycorrhizal and rhizobacterial inoculants adapted for hydroponic root zone conditions is advancing for plant growth promotion and disease suppression in commercial controlled environment crop production. Growing adoption at organic and biological growing programs is being driven by the crop health improvement from beneficial microbe root zone establishment.
- Elemental ratio balance modeling for hydroponic nutrient formulation using plant nutrient absorption stoichiometry data for crop-specific target formulation across growth stages is advancing as a precision agronomic tool for hydroponic nutrient solution design. Growing adoption at commercial plant factory programs is being driven by the crop nutrient status improvement from stoichiometry-based formulation.

7. Key Market Trends (2026–2034)
Three major forces are shaping the Hydroponic Nutrient Market trajectory over the forecast period:
Commercial Plant Factory and Vertical Farm Scale-Up Is Growing Industrial-Volume Nutrient Supply Demand.Commercial plant factory operators and vertical farm companies requiring large-volume crop-specific nutrient solution supply for continuous high-density indoor growing are generating growing industrial-scale hydroponic nutrient procurement from large-format nutrient concentrate supply programs. Haifa Group and ICL Specialty Fertilizers expanded commercial plant factory nutrient supply programs in 2024 for commercial indoor growing operator large-volume nutrient procurement.
Cannabis Indoor Cultivation Specialty Nutrient Market Is Generating High-Value Nutrient Program Procurement.Licensed cannabis indoor cultivators implementing proprietary nutrient programs for cannabinoid content optimization and maximum flower yield are generating premium hydroponic nutrient product procurement from cannabis cultivation specialty nutrient brands positioned on high-performance growing outcomes. General Hydroponics (Hawthorne) and Fox Farm expanded cannabis cultivation nutrient program supply in 2024 for licensed commercial cannabis indoor facility nutrient program procurement.
Organic Hydroponic Nutrient Certification Growth Is Growing Demand for OMRI-Listed Nutrient Solutions.Commercial hydroponic growers and urban farmers seeking USDA organic certification or certified naturally grown label compliance for hydroponic produce programs are increasing OMRI-listed organic hydroponic nutrient procurement from certified organic nutrient suppliers for compliance with organic certification requirements. BioControls (BioWorks) and Dragonfly Earth Medicine expanded certified organic hydroponic nutrient supply programs in 2024 for organic certifiable hydroponic grower nutrient procurement.

9. Regional Analysis
Regional demand patterns across the Hydroponic Nutrient Market reflect differences in regulation, technological maturity, and capital investment.
Largest Market Share
North America dominated the Hydroponic Nutrient Market in 2025, with a market share of 36.4% of the global market. Licensed cannabis indoor cultivation generates the largest single end-use segment of North American hydroponic nutrient demand through the premium specialty nutrient program market from commercial cannabis cultivator growing programs. US and Canadian commercial plant factory and vertical farm operator nutrient procurement generates growing industrial-volume nutrient demand. Hydroponic hobby and home grower nutrient sales in North America contribute significant consumer-packaged nutrient product volume.
Highest CAGR Region
Asia Pacific is expected to register the highest CAGR of 13.00% during the forecast period. Japan's mature plant factory sector and growing commercial controlled environment agriculture generate consistent industrial nutrient demand. Chinese commercial hydroponic nutrient production is generating growing domestic market supply alongside export. South Korean and Singaporean plant factory and vertical farm development is creating growing nutrient procurement from commercial indoor growing facility operations.
